当你在TP钱包里看到“矿工等待确认”,心里其实会冒出两个问题:为什么迟迟不进区块?以及此刻如何避免多签劫持、钓鱼重放与地址风险?别急,先把流程拆开——再把风险收口。
**一、矿工等待确认:到底在等什么**
区块链交易通常经历:钱包签名→广播到网络→进入内存池(mempool)→矿工打包并产生确认。若你迟迟看到“矿工等待确认”,常见原因包括:网络拥堵导致交易在内存池排队、矿工费用(gas/矿工费)设置偏低、节点传播延迟、或链上出现短时重组(reorg)。建议优先核对交易哈希是否已被链浏览器记录;若未上链,通常仍在内存池等待。
**二、网络风险防范:把“等待”变成可控变量**
1)**校验链与合约**:确认你发的是预期网络与合约地址,跨链操作更要对齐链ID。
2)**避免重复广播与盲目加速**:在确认前反复点击可能造成多笔交易进入队列。
3)**使用权威浏览器核对**:例如以区块浏览器/官方链上探针为准,或使用钱包内置验证入口。
4)**防钓鱼与签名劫持**:只在可信页面提交签名;任何“复制助记词/私钥”的弹窗都应视为高危。
**三、矿场与调度:理解费用市场**
矿工是否打包取决于交易费率与竞价机制。你设置的gas越高,越可能在拥堵时优先被处理。关于费用市场与拥堵处理,学界与工程界普遍强调“费率与区块空间竞争”这一逻辑;以以太坊相关讨论为例,交易费市场机制与内存池排队的特性可参考以太坊官方文档与EIP相关资料(例如关于EIP-1559费用机制的公开说明)。
**四、图标设计优化:让用户少走弯路**

把安全做成“看得懂的界面”是关键。针对TP钱包交易状态,可做以下优化:
- 状态分层:如“已广播/内存池排队/已打包/已确认”,避免只用“等待确认”一个词。
- 费用可视化:将当前费率与建议费率用色块呈现(绿色:与网络拥堵匹配;橙色:可能延迟;红色:低于阈值)。
- 风险图标:对“可疑合约/地址不在本地白名单/高风险授权”使用统一警示图标,并给出一句可执行建议(如“检查合约地址”)。
**五、跨链互操作解决方案:减少“对不齐”造成的失败**
跨链并非只靠“复制粘贴”。应采用:
- 统一资产映射与链ID校验;
- 使用具备多链消息验证的互操作框架(确保消息证明与状态验证);
- 在钱包侧提供“跨链路径提示”,让用户理解源链锁定/目标链铸造的关键节点。
**六、地址黑名单:从“事后排查”到“事前拦截”**

实现方式可包括:本地维护风险地址列表(如诈骗合约、已知恶意合约、频繁参与洗币的地址段)+ 远端更新;在转账前对收款地址/合约地址进行匹配检测。注意:黑名单应与可信数据源同步,避免误伤正常合约。
**七、助记词恢复机制:把灾难变成流程**
助记词是最高权限凭证,恢复应遵循:
1)在离线/可信环境操作;2)确认恢复页的来源域名与应用签名;3)严格按顺序输入并校验;4)恢复后立即检查余额与授权状态,必要时撤销危险授权。
权威建议通常强调:助记词不得被任何第三方索取;任何“代恢复”服务都需高度警惕。
——所以,当你再次遇到“矿工等待确认”,不要只等:先查链上记录,再评估费率,再核对地址与网络,必要时再做受控的加速/重发策略。把每一步变成可验证的动作,你就能在波动里保持掌控。
评论
ByteWanderer
终于有人把“等待确认”拆成内存池、费率和链上核对了,逻辑很清晰!
小夜猫Luna
图标优化那段很实用:状态分层+费率可视化如果做出来,用户会少踩坑。
SoraKernel
跨链互操作建议里提到链ID校验,感觉是很多失败交易的根因。
ZhouMina
地址黑名单实现方式写得比较落地,但也提醒误伤,平衡感不错。
MangoRail
助记词恢复强调离线可信环境,尤其是“代恢复服务警惕”这句很关键。